What Are Overnight Oats?

Overnight oats are a convenient breakfast that is made by soaking raw oats in any liquid, typically milk or a dairy-free alternative (such as coconut, soy, or almond milk) overnight in the fridge. By soaking them for 8-12 hours, the oats soften and absorb the liquid and as a result, they require no additional cooking. 

The benefits of overnight oats include their versatility and easy preparation. Once you’ve soaked the oats, you can customize them based on your goals, needs, and preferences. From fresh fruits and nuts to seeds, spices, and sweeteners, the possibilities are endless, which allows for multiple flavor combinations. 

Are Overnight Oats Healthy for Weight Loss? 

Yes, overnight oats can be healthy for weight loss. However, it all comes down to the ingredients you add. To lose weight, you need to be in a caloric deficit, meaning that you need to eat fewer calories than your body needs (3). 

This means that you should keep track of your overnight oats and the rest of the meals you make throughout the day.

Now, there are advantages that overnight oats have regarding weight loss. Here are some of the factors that can contribute to weight loss from overnight oats: 

  • Fiber content. Overnight oats are high in fiber, primarily from the oats. Fiber takes longer to digest, so it promotes feelings of fullness and satiety (5). As a consequence, it can lead to reduced portion sizes, resulting in a caloric deficit. 
  • Protein content. Protein is another key nutrient for weight loss. It helps preserve lean muscle mass and increase fullness levels (1). 
  • Customization. The versatility of overnight oats offers endless customization to help you achieve your calorie and macro needs. As a result, it can be a great option to fit any meal plan that promotes weight loss. 
  • Perfect for meal prep. Another way overnight oats can promote weight loss is that it’s perfect to use for meal prepping. You can make several jars for the week, which will allow you to stay on track with your daily calories.

Overnight Oats Benefits

Weight Management

Thanks to their high fiber and low fat content, overnight oats can promote feelings of fullness, which can help with weight management. As oats are a slow-digesting carb, they can help you feel satisfied for longer, preventing mid-morning hunger that often leads to unhealthy snacking.

Heart Health

Oats are high in beta-glucans, a type of soluble fiber that provides oats with incredible heart health benefits. Research has shown that fiber acts as a broom in the body, removing cholesterol particles. Therefore, it can lead to reduced LDL (bad) cholesterol levels, which lowers the risk of heart disease (2).

Sustained Energy 

The balance of macronutrients in overnight oats makes them an excellent source of sustained energy. The combination of complex carbs, fiber, and protein means you’re less likely to experience the sugar crashes that are associated with a high-sugar breakfast (4). 

Digestive Health

The high fiber content in oats can lead to better gut health. Not only does it act as a prebiotic, meaning it can feed the bacteria in the gut and keep it strong, it can also help reduce the risk of constipation.

Are Overnight Oats Healthier than Regular Oatmeal?

Determining if overnight oats are healthier than regular oats depends on several factors, including ingredients, nutritional needs, and preparation methods. 

For example, if we were to compare processed oats (made with quick oats, sugar, and other ingredients) with a simple overnight oats with milk recipe, then the answer is simple. Yes, overnight oats are healthier than regular oatmeal. 

However, if we were to compare steel-cut oats or rolled oats made in milk or water against overnight oats made with chocolate, peanut butter, and chocolate chips, then steel-cut oats would be the better option.

Tips for Making Overnight Oats Healthy

As we’ve seen, overnight oats can be a healthy breakfast, but it depends on the ingredients you add. Here are some tips to help you create healthy and balanced overnight oats. 

  • Choose whole-grain oats. Instead of instant oats, opt for rolled oats or steel-cut oats as they are less processed and retain more fiber and nutrients. Whole-grain oats provide complex carbs for sustained energy and are rich in fiber.
  • Include a protein source. Include a protein source in your overnight oats to enhance satiety and support muscle repair and growth. Include options such as Greek yogurt, protein powder, chia seeds, hemp seeds, and nuts. 
  • Add healthy fats. Incorporate healthy fats into your overnight oats for added flavor and satiety. Nut butter, chia seeds, flax seeds, hemp seeds, and chopped nuts are great sources of healthy fats, omega-3 fatty acids, vitamins, and minerals. 
  • Sweeten naturally. Avoid adding excessive amounts of sugar to your overnight oats. Instead, opt for natural ways to sweeten your overnight oats, such as using dates, unsweetened applesauce, mashed bananas, a drizzle of honey, or maple syrup. If you’re looking for a sugar-free alternative, try stevia or monk fruit. 
  • Increase fiber add-ins. Boost the fiber content of your overnight oats by adding fiber-rich ingredients, such as shredded coconut, chia seeds, hemp seeds, or ground flaxseeds. 
  • Use natural spices. Add different foods to change the flavor of your overnight oats. Mix different herbs, spices, or other flavorings, such as cinnamon, vanilla extract, almond extract, cocoa powder, nutmeg, ginger, and pumpkin spice.

  • Are overnight oats healthy for people with diabetes?

Overnight oats can be a healthy option for people with diabetes. They are known to have a low glycemic index, which means they won’t spike your blood sugar levels. However, you must make sure you choose whole-grain oats and avoid sugars to help promote stable blood sugar levels. Always make sure to consult a health professional for personalized dietary advice that is tailored to your needs. 

  • Are overnight oats healthy for cholesterol?

Overnight oats can be healthy for cholesterol thanks to their high fiber content. In addition, their high beta-glucan content can help reduce bad cholesterol and promote good heart health. Make sure to avoid added sugars and opt instead for unsaturated fats for toppings.
